Learn how to identify and resolve scheduling conflicts in VeriClock when overlapping or conflicting shifts occur. This guide explains how conflict warnings appear when saving shifts, how to review unresolved conflicts, and how to edit, delete, or dismiss conflicting shifts to ensure accurate and conflict-free schedules before or after publishing.
When saving a shift, if a time conflict occurs, a conflicting shift popup will display on the screen. Clicking on Cancel will redirect you back to the shift to make changes. Clicking on Ignore & Publish will allow you to publish the shift and resolve the conflict after the shift has been saved.
Conflicts
Unresolved shift conflicts are displayed in the top right corner of the screen and represented by an icon with an exclamation point inside a triangle. A red circle will note the number of unresolved conflicts that need to be addressed. Conflicts are displayed in the week they occur. To resolve conflicts, click on the conflict icon.
A popup window displays a list of all shift conflicts. Use the gray scroll bar on the right hand side of the window to scroll up and down through conflicts. Click the Delete button to delete a conflicting shift. Click Edit to edit a shift so that it will no longer cause a conflict. Click Dismiss /Ignore Conflict button to allow the conflicting shifts. Conflicts could even occur for shifts that are saved as drafts and are not yet published. Drafts causing a conflict will show up when clicking on the conflict icon.
When all conflicts have been resolved, No Conflicts will pop up when clicking on the conflict icon.
